Las Rosas is a city and municipality in the Mexican state of Chiapas in southern Mexico.
As of 2010, the city of Las Rosas had a population of 18,817.
[1] Other than the city of Las Rosas, the municipality had 130 localities, none of which had a population over 1,000.
[1] In June 2020 some inhabitants attacked the vehicles of health workers, believing that dengue and coronavirus precautions were measures to wipe out the local population.
